git: Fix deprecated subsection config syntax
Apparently marking subsections like `[section.subsection]` (toml-like)
is deprecated in the configuration. This commit fixes this by using the
recommended `[section "subsection"]` syntax.

See: https://git-scm.com/docs/git-config#_syntax

git: Make git diff termcolor aware
Added simple light/dark distinction for git diffs using delta.
Will use the TERM_DARK env variable which is set in the base
module functionality on opening a new term.

This means unfortunately git diffs will have the wrong color
when terms recently changed between light-dark but on opening
a new one the error is gone and it automatically adapts again
to the terminal background color.

78e678fe1f
git: Add main branch methods, Fix pushall
Fixed 'pushall' option xargs error.

Added dealing with 'main' branch instead of 'master' branch in checkout
and rebase aliases, so that when invoking the commands it will default
to a master branch and fall back to a main branch before complaining
that no corresponding branch exists.

Should (silently) fix git repositories which switched to main in the
last few months, and simultaneously allows me to switch this repository
to main branch (already done.)

6380affb6f Add basic XDG compliant sh architecture
The only file left in $HOME is .zshenv, which sets up zsh to source everything from XDG_CONFIG_HOME/zsh.
Shell files are split into sh and zsh directories, for global assignments (which should be posix compliant, work on any posix shell) like environemnt variables, xdg vars, and global aliases. zsh contains zsh specific customization (prompt customization, plugin loading, zsh completions).

Zsh initialization will pull from sh directory first, loading the respective mirror to its startup file (`.zprofile` loads `sh/profile` and `profile.d/*`, `.zshenv` loads `sh/env` and `sh/env.d/*` and `zsh/env.d/*`, `.zshrc` loads `sh/alias`, `sh/alias.d/*` and `zsh/alias.d/*`)

Once all is done, it will have loaded both global variables, aliases and settings, and zsh-only specifications. Other stow modules, if they want to add shell functionality, can include their aliases and functions in one of the above directories to automatically be picked up by zsh.
